
McCoughtry Named adidas Rookie of the Month for August
September 03, 2009 | Women's Basketball
Sept. 3, 2009
Louisville, Ky. - Former Louisville All-American Angel McCoughtry was named the WNBA's adidas Rookie of the Month for the month of August. It is the second straight month for the award, McCoughtry recieved the honor in July as well.
In 10 games, McCoughtry led all rookies and the Atlanta Dream in scoring with 17.3 points per game, which placed her among the Top 10 in the league. She also led all rookies in steals with 3.4 per game and ranked third in rebounds 3.4 per game and assists at 2.4 per game. McCoughtry scored a career-high 34 points in a 93-87 win over San Antonio. Over the month, she helped the Dream to a 6-4 record and scored in double digits in each game, including three outings in which she finished with 20 or more points.
McCoughtry has added depth to an Atlanta team that finished its inaugural season with only four wins. The Dream currently holds the second place spot in the Eastern Conference with a 16-14 record and is on the verge of their first playoff berth. McCoughtry has scored double digits in 21 of 30 games to date this season, and currently ranks sixth in the league in steals per game (2.2).
Below are the highlights of McCoughtry's outstanding month:
Aug. 1 vs. New York: Career-high seven steals and 16 points in an 89-83 win
Aug. 20 vs. San Antonio: Career-high 34 points in a 93-87 win
Aug. 23 vs. Los Angeles: 23 points, including 11-20 in field goals and five steals in a 91-87 loss
Aug. 25 vs. Sacramento: 20 points including 7-8 in free-throws in a 103-83 win
